Abstract

The metal-free phthalocyanine 2 was synthesized from the 4,5-bis(1,4,7,10-tetraoxacyclododecan-2-ylmethoxy)phthalonitrile 1 in the presence of a strong base in n-pentanol. The synthesis of metallo derivatives [Ni(II), Co(II), Cu(II)] of phthalocyanines obtained from corresponding phthalonitrile derivative 1 and in the presence of the anhydrous divalent metal salts (NiCl2, CoCl2 and CuCl2) were described. The thermal stabilities of the metal-free and metallophthalocyanines were determined by thermogravimetric analysis. These phthalocyanines were good soluble inorganic solvents such as chloroform, dichloromethane, tetrahydrofuran and DMF. The products were characterized by elemental analysis, IR, H-1 NMR, UV-vis and MS spectral data.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
